Replying to: rsholland (Sep 24, 2009 5:22 am) I am not 100% sure but think there is a differnce between the Prado which is part of the Landcruiser lineup and the 4Runner which was originally derived from the Hi-Lux. The Prado sold in Australia is a serious 4WD, although less truck like than the full size Landcruiser. \The 2010 modle was launched a week or so ago, actually being launched in Ausrtalia before Japan http://www.smh.com.au/drive/motor-news/first-look-allnew-toyota-prado-20090914-f- nfg.html The 4-Runner has not been sold in Australia for many years, probably because it would overlap with the Prado market segment. Cheers Graham

Greetings. I am changing the spark plugs on my 2002 Outback, 2.5 ltr engine. I found oil puddled in the space at the top of there sparkpug wells where there appears to be gaskets. The plugs are not oil fouled and there is no oil running down the outside of the engine. Is this something I should be concerned about? Thanks
